The production of our elbows takes place according to the well-known "Hamburg procedure".
In this case, a smaller diameter starting pipe is pushed under continuous inductive heating over a widening-bending mandrel and thus brought into the shape of a pipe bend.
  Following this bending process, the sheet is given its final shape by calibration in a separate press.

In our production furnaces (rotary hearth furnace up to 950 ° C, single-chamber furnace up to 1250 ° C), pipes and blanks are heated to forming temperature in order to prepare them for the subsequent forming processes.
